"What Lies Beneath Matters" is a book written by registered psychologist Grace da Camara and her daughter, Dr. Madalena Bennett, a general practitioner. The book is designed to support parents of tweens and teens with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) in improving the quality of parent-child interaction and fostering a more informed understanding of ADHD.

Key Themes

  1. Parent-Child Interaction: The book focuses on enhancing the relationship between parents and their children with ADHD, providing strategies to improve communication and understanding.
  2. ADHD Support: It offers practical methods and insights to help parents better support their children with ADHD, addressing both the child's needs and the family's overall well-being.
  3. Personal Experiences: The authors share their personal experiences, drawing from their professional expertise and their own family dynamics, to provide a relatable and practical approach.
